It's a non-denominational gathering of enthusiasts (Ferrari, Porsche, Lambo, Aston, McLaren, etc) that meet on dry Saturday mornings. See http://www.exoticsat.com/

Great people, 200+ rare & interesting cars on good days from early spring through late fall. I drive 150 miles each way to attend a few times a year, and have been there for British Car day the last 2 years running.
